I Smile Back

2015 - 1.8/5

Sarah Silverman as Laney was amazing. She portrayed the bleakness of the character so well. Even the guy that played her husband and her kids did a good job too.

One thing that I didn’t really get was whether or not her husband knew about her drug addiction/cheating ways before she woke him up. It’s hard to tell because her husband seems to sweep the issue under the rug and doesn’t want to talk about and he seems to have the “can’t you just be happy” approach to whatever mental issues Laney was going through (why she was taking pills in the first place).

I do like how it ended (Laney walking out of the house) because it seemed more realistic than her staying at home and everything being okay. When it comes to what lead Laney to have a bloody face, I think that wasn’t really necessary; she could have just fallen down a flight of stairs after she had sex with that guy in the bar.

There were a few parts of the movie that when it happened, I thought it wasn’t necessary, however, as a whole, it did work. That’s not to say that this movie is groundbreaking in any way.
